What are the responsibilities and job description for the Electrical Engineer 2 position at Ascential Technologies?
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S:
- Designing controls systems for custom machines utilizing EPLAN, AutoCAD Electric or Electrical, including Pneumatic and Hydraulic designs
- Navigate customer specifications to ensure machine designs meet customer standards (ex GM GCCH, Ford GVOSS, etc.)
- Ability to think conceptually, work in parallel with mechanical designs in development
- Work with Manufacturing Engineering to develop assembly, process control and quality workmanship procedures
- Effective communication between program managers and controls engineers to keep flow of project maintained
- Keeping updated on the field’s concepts, practices, and procedures
SKILLS & EXPERIENCE:
- 5 years industry experience
- Minimum 2 years’ experience with EPLAN
- Ability to make changes quickly and work in a team environment
- Ability to work on multiple projects concurrently
- Ability to size electrical systems proficiently, familiarity with UL508A
- Familiarity with NFPA 79, ANSI B11, and other common Auto Industry standards
